1988 Mercedes-Benz W124 200 review from Sweden
"Comfortable and economical"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
Gas pump at 42000km
Rear axis broke off at 46000km
W124´s tend to rust a lot
Minor oil leakage
Noisy "ticking" hydraulic valve lifters and camshaft
Bad suspension
General comments?
Positives:
Comfortable highway cruiser that looks good
Very reliable, especially in the winters
Good heating
High quality materials
Relatively easy to repair and maintain
Low fuel consumption
Negatives:
Slow
Rust!!!
